The New Normal: Hybrid Workspaces

One thing that has become evident over the past 18 months has been the need for flexibility in the workplace. Gone are the days of working 9 to 5 in a designated office space. We’ve seen most businesses pivoting and adopting a hybrid model, where employees spend a few days working remotely at home and the other days working out of a brick and mortar office space.

Hybrid workspaces appear to be the new normal as we know it. Remote workers need a change of scenery and to separate their home from the office once again… but not necessarily each day of the week.
